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Barnstaple to Bishopbriggs start from £189.90 one way, or £271.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Barnstaple to Bishopbriggs are available for £196.50 one way, or £393.00 return

Facilities and Services at Barnstaple Station

Barnstaple Station is equipped with a host of facilities to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 17:50 on weekdays and Saturday, and from 09:20 to 16:40 on Sundays, ensuring you have ample time to purchase or collect your tickets via accessible machines which are equipped with induction loops. For online ticket purchasers, collection is straightforward at the station machines.

For those needing assistance, staff are on hand at designated times across the week, ready to provide help from conveniently located help points. Accessibility is a key feature at Barnstaple, with step-free access and ramps available, ensuring smooth transitions around the station for all passengers.

Toilets and Waiting Areas

Facilities are on hand to make your wait and journey more convenient. This includes available toilets on Platform 1, though it is important to note they are not accessible for disabled passengers. Waiting rooms are accessible during ticket office hours and offer seating areas for a relaxing pause before departure.

Car Parking and Cycling Facilities

APCOA operates the station car park with 116 spaces available, including six accessible spaces. Charges are competitive with options for daily and longer-term stays. For cycling enthusiasts, there are 12 bike storage spaces with additional facilities for hiring bikes, making Barnstaple a cycle-friendly station that aligns with the adventurous spirit of the region.

Facilities and Amenities

When it comes to ticketing, Bishopbriggs Train Station ensures convenience. The ticket office operates Monday through Saturday from 06:36 to 20:30, complemented by ticket machines for quick purchases and collections, including those bought online. With accessible machines and induction loops for the hearing impaired, ticketing is accommodating to different needs. Customer assistance is readily available, with staff present during ticket office hours and help points around the station. Moreover, the station boasts a commendable level of security with CCTV surveillance. However, it's worth noting the absence of luggage storage, toilets, and refreshment facilities. Waiting rooms are incorporated into the ticket office, providing a comfortable spot to rest while you await your train.

Accessibility Features

Accessibility at Bishopbriggs Station is a mixed bag, and those with mobility challenges should be aware that step-free access is limited. The station is categorized as B2, meaning there are steep ramps and a footbridge with stairs connecting platforms. While accessible ticket machines are available, other features like accessible toilets and designated pickup points for those with impaired mobility aren’t provided. There’s no step-free access to all areas, so plan accordingly.
